Hello Everyone

I have retrieved my 1981 Audi 4000 5+5 from its shipping container and have brought it home. This was my personal car in the mid 1980s. It has been idle since the mid 1990s and has sat in storage. The body is in VERY good condition and that is to be expected, as it was in a low humidity environment. I have not tried to start it and I’m sure the fuel and brakes need going through. This thing only has 63,000 miles. The interior looks as good as the exterior. Here are a few images. Is there a market amongst you officionadios for this rare bird?

Any update? I'd be reluctant to sell a really nice 5+5 just because most of the time it's people looking to cut it up to make a SportQ. And many of those will never get around to it, so the car will end up rotting away.
